    Floor drain hoses

    Many posts on this. Port side may be doable with batteries removed, starboard side, nearly impossible without cutting. could remove the diesel tank and get to it with long arms, but much less work to cut and put a cover plate on the starboard side. There are numerous posts on this.

    Freedom 235 Drain Plug Question

    It’s probably fine. That is a tapered, brass fitting (NPT). It will not completely seat, if it was me, I would remove it, clean the threads put some thread compound on it and tighten it back in to snug with a wrench or maybe 20 foot pounds.     New Canvas - what to do

    When I installed my new Canvas, I let it hang for 2 to 3 days, then pulled it tight by hand marking where the snaps would go. It now stays nice and tight regardless of the outside air temperature and has been that way for three or four years now. Of course, the longer it is in the vertical...

    New Canvas - what to do

    Depending on your temperature, let your Canvas hang for a day or two before you install the snaps. It will stretch out and the Canvas will be loose if you do it too early.
